APLIKASI METODE POTENSIOMETRI SEL KONSENTRASI UNTUK ANALISIS LOGAM TEMBAGA (Cu) PADA AIR SUNGAI SEKANAK KOTA PALEMBANG
Validation of the potentiometric cell concentration method and analysis of copper metal in Sekanak river water has been carried out. This research aims to validate the concentration cell potentiometric method in determining copper metal (Cu) in water and determining the distribution of copper metal (Cu) in Sekanak river water. Validation parameters in this study include calibration curve linearity, detection limit (LoD), quantification limit (LoQ), precision, accuracy and measurement uncertainty estimates. The concentration cell potentiometric method was proven to be valid in determining the presence of copper metal in water with a coefficient of determination value of 0.9989, a high level of accuracy or average recovery of 99.58%, and a precision or RSD value of 1.26% fall into the conscientious category. Apart from that, the LoD and LoQ method values were also obtained at 1.135x10-6 mol/L and 1.417x10-6 mol/L. The distribution of copper metal in water tends to fluctuate from upstream to downstream.
